Terri, if they tell you you've run out of data, it means you have. Check your account to see how much data has been used by your household. Hughesnet doesn't use your data at all; your devices do. Are you streaming? That eats an awful lot of data very fast. Take the amount of data you get per month and divide it into 31 days. That will give you the average amount of data you can use per day to stay within the monthly allowance. If you use more than that every day, you'll run out.
